DOCS
SQL es SQL para JSON con sintaxis ANSI estándar del sector. SQL++ soporta conceptos comunes como transacciones ACID, esquemas jerárquicos llamados ámbitos y uniones entre documentos. También aprovecha nuestra optimización patentada basada en costes.
Cambiar las consultas a un nuevo lenguaje es costoso. SQL++ cumple los estándares ANSI 92, lo que hace que la migración de SQL a Couchbase sea más rápida y sencilla.
Escribir consultas puede ser complejo y provocar lentitud si se ejecutan incorrectamente. Nuestro optimizador basado en costes (CBO) garantiza el mejor rendimiento.
Usar múltiples bases de datos para una aplicación lleva a la inconsistencia de los datos. Couchbase puede dar soporte a todos tus casos de uso con una única base de datos multimodelo.
Aprender un nuevo lenguaje de consulta propietario para una base de datos es todo un reto. SQL++ permite a los desarrolladores utilizar sus conocimientos de ANSI SQL para JSON.
Desarrolle aplicaciones atractivas con facilidad utilizando un lenguaje de base de datos de consulta JSON completo y declarativo. Los desarrolladores pueden adaptarse rápidamente a los cambiantes requisitos empresariales mediante un almacén de documentos JSON sin esquemas.
SQL++ es un lenguaje de consulta NoSQL de alto rendimiento con optimizadores incorporados y habilitadores de indexadores para soportar millones de interacciones concurrentes con latencias por debajo del milisegundo. La arquitectura multidimensional de Couchbase utiliza SQL++ en sus servicios de consulta, índice, búsqueda y análisis, particionando para escalar elásticamente la capacidad de datos y ofrecer un rendimiento de consulta acelerado.
Se accede a SQL++ a través del Query Workbench y dispone de una función integrada de asesoramiento sobre índices que indica al desarrollador qué índices son necesarios para optimizar su consulta. Flex Index utiliza el índice de búsqueda invertido del Full-Text Search Service para predicados de consulta complicados. Couchbase también incluye un optimizador basado en costes y funciones definidas por el usuario basadas en JavaScript para manipular los datos resultantes.